London as a Starting Point for Senior Adventures

London serves as a vibrant and accessible hub for senior travelers. From here, seniors can join a variety of curated experiences designed with their needs in mind. London day tours for seniors are excellent options for those who prefer shorter excursions. These tours often cover iconic landmarks such as Buckingham Palace, the Tower of London, and the British Museum, all while maintaining a comfortable pace.

For those with mobility concerns, there are specific London tours for seniors with limited mobility that focus on accessible transport, step-free access, and minimal walking. These tours ensure that everyone can enjoy the capital’s cultural and historical highlights without physical strain. Features commonly included in these tours are:

  • Accessible transportation with low-floor coaches
  • Guides trained in mobility assistance
  • Scheduled breaks and seated attractions

Choosing the Right Tour for Your Needs

When selecting a senior-friendly tour, it’s important to consider your personal comfort, mobility, and interests. Whether you’re interested in art, history, countryside views, or coastal towns, there’s likely a tour suited to your preferences. Best London tours for seniors often highlight museums, theater outings, and scenic river cruises, offering a variety of activities in a manageable timeframe.

Before booking a tour, consider looking into:

  • Group size – smaller groups may allow for a more personalized experience
  • Pace – ensure the itinerary allows for adequate rest and leisure
  • Accessibility – check for wheelchair access and support for limited mobility

Reading reviews and asking for recommendations from fellow travelers can also help narrow down the options. Tour operators focusing on older adults often go the extra mile in terms of service and consideration.

Tips for a Comfortable and Enjoyable Trip

Preparation is key to enjoying your UK coach tour to the fullest. Here are some essential tips for seniors planning a coach-based vacation:

  • Pack light, but include essentials like medications, a reusable water bottle, and a travel pillow
  • Bring layers of clothing to adjust to varied UK weather conditions
  • Keep important documents and emergency contact information easily accessible

Many UK coach tours for seniors from London also provide pre-tour checklists and packing guides, which can be helpful for first-time travelers. Don’t hesitate to reach out to the tour provider with any questions about accessibility, meals, or accommodations to ensure everything aligns with your needs.
